Example Definitions of "Guaranty"
Guaranty. Shall mean each guaranty delivered to Lender by a Guarantor in respect of the Obligations, as amended, restated, supplemented and/or otherwise modified from time to time as permitted thereunder.
Guaranty. Means the Unconditional Guaranty Agreement substantially in the form attached hereto as Exhibit "J," as the same may be amended, modified, restated or extended from time to time.
Guaranty. The word "Guaranty" means the guaranty from Guarantor to Lender, including without limitation a guaranty of all of part of the Note.
Guaranty. The Limited Guaranty Agreement, and any amendments thereto.
Guaranty. Shall have the meaning set forth in Section 5A.01(b).
Guaranty. Means that certain Unconditional Guaranty made by the Company in favor of Holder, dated as of the date hereof.
Guaranty. As used in the Credit Agreement and the other Loan Documents, shall mean the Original Guaranty, as amended by this Amendment and the First Amendment to and Reaffirmation of Guaranty.
Guaranty. Shall mean the Continuing Guaranty dated as of August 20, 2008 executed by Parent in favor of Holder.
Guaranty. Shall mean this Subsidiary Guaranty as the same may be modified, supplemented or amended from time to time in accordance with it terms.
Guaranty. Unless otherwise provided herein, all capitalized or other terms in this Guaranty shall have the meanings specified in the Credit Agreement.
